Changing Cycles, Modifiers, and Options You can change Automatic and Manual Cycles, Modifiers, and Options anytime before pressing Start. ■ Three short tones sound if an unavailable combination is selected. The last selection will not be accepted. Changing Cycles after pressing Start/Pause 1. Press START/PAUSE twice. 2. Select the desired cycle and options. 3. Press START/PAUSE. The dryer starts at the beginning of the new cycle. NOTE: If you do not press Start within 5 minutes of selecting the cycle, the dryer automatically shuts off. Changing Modifiers and Options after pressing Start/Pause You can change an Option or Modifier anytime before the selected Option or Modifier begins. 1. Press START/PAUSE once. 2. Select the new Option and/or Modifiers. 3. Press START/PAUSE to continue the cycle. NOTE: If you happen to press START/PAUSE twice, the program clears and your dryer shuts down. Restart the selection process. Changing the Preset Dryness Level Settings If all of your loads on all Automatic cycles are consistently not as dry as you would like, you may change the preset Dryness Level settings to increase the dryness. This change will affect all of your Automatic cycles. Your Dryness Level settings can be adjusted to adapt to different installations, environmental conditions or personal preference. There are 3 drying settings: 1 (factory preset dryness level), 2 (slightly dryer clothes, approximately 15% more drying time), and 3 (much dryer clothes, approximately 30% more drying time). 1. The Dryness Level settings cannot be changed while the dryer is running. 2. Press and hold the DRYNESS LEVEL button for 5 seconds. The dryer will beep, and "CF" will be displayed for 1 second followed by the current drying setting. 3. To select a new drying setting, press the DRYNESS LEVELbutton again until the desired drying setting is shown. NOTE: While cycling through the settings, the current setting will not flash, but the other settings will flash. 4. Press START/PAUSE to save the drying setting. 5. The drying setting you selected will become your new preset drying setting for all Automatic cycles. Drying Rack Option Use the Drying Rack to dry items such as sweaters and pillows without tumbling. The drum turns, but the drying rack does not move. If your model does not have a drying rack, you may be able to purchase one for your model. To find out whether your model allows drying rack usage and for information on ordering, please refer to the front page of the manual or contact the dealer from whom you purchased your dryer. NOTE: The drying rack must be removed for normal tumbling. Do not use the automatic cycle with the drying rack. To use the drying rack 1. Open dryer door. A A. Front edge 2. Place drying rack inside dryer drum, positioning the back wire on the ledge of the inner dryer back panel. Push down on front edge of drying rack to secure at the front of the dryer. B A A. Drying rack front edge B. Dryer back panel 3. Put the wet items on top of the drying rack. Leave space between the items so air can reach all the surfaces. NOTE: Do not allow items to hang over the edge of the drying rack. 4. Close the door. 5. Press the POWER button. 6. Select Manual Cycle and select a temperature (see following chart). Items containing foam, rubber or plastic must be dried on a clothesline or by using the Air Only temperature setting. 7. You must select a time by pressing TIME ADJUST Up or Down. Reset time as needed to complete drying. Refer to the following table. 8. Press (and hold) START/PAUSE button (about 1 second). 9
